Web5 apr. 2024 · The tidal range describes the vertical elevation difference between high and low tides; because of their configuration and that of the coastal seafloor, coastlines see greater tidal ranges – often 5 to 10 feet – than the open ocean. The Bay of Fundy in southeastern Canada sees the world’s greatest tidal range: 50 feet or more. WebThe statute dictated that the high tide line be determined through analysis of field evidence including wrack lines, vegetation patterns, or other evidence; however, due to the … Web1 dec. 2024 · Coastal Regulation Zones (CRZ) are the areas along the 7,500 km-long coastal stretch of India. As per the official notification, the coastal land up to 500m from the High Tide Line (HTL) and a stage of 100m along banks of creeks, estuaries, backwater and rivers subject to tidal fluctuations, is called the Coastal Regulation Zone.

Web14 feb. 2024 · A cotidal line is a line on a map connecting points at which a tidal level, especially high tide, occurs simultaneously. Cotidal lines are hypothetical tidal crest rotating around an amphidromic point (Figure 11.15). Cotidal lines rotate around amphidromic points about every 12 hours. Coastal Condition Forecasts Nowcast and … skyline finance group llcWebCalifornia’s coastal zone generally extends 1,000 yards inland from the mean high tide line. In significant coastal estuarine habitat and recreational areas it extends inland to the first major ridgeline or 5 miles from the mean high tide line, whichever is less. The low intertidal zone, which borders on the shallow subtidal zone, is only exposed to air at the lowest of low tides and is primarily marine in character.
